Output e78cc2aed39b76131a111fa109dfc495aecaa0db40aa07fcf8c87824030415fe:0

value
29607840
script pubkey
OP_0 OP_PUSHBYTES_20 7a86ac1fbe3ba4b275990381f3eec5eb298ea341
address
bc1q02r2c8a78wjtyaveqwql8mk9av5cag6pmrqcy2
transaction
e78cc2aed39b76131a111fa109dfc495aecaa0db40aa07fcf8c87824030415fe
confirmations
173275
spent
true